FTP/SFTP Connection
For Connection:
- Enter the hostname of the remote FTP server and the folder path provided by the source in the Host and Path fields, respectively. The default FTP port is 21.
- Make sure the connection settings match those of the SFTP server. Enter the Path to the required folder.
- Enable Use SSH Key Authentication to open the configuration window. SSH Key Authentication is used for connecting to the source SFTP server.
- For Authentication, enter the Username provided by the source.
- Click the Import Private Key button and Import SSH Key will open.
- Copy and paste the Private Key.
- Enter Password.
- Click Import and the Public Key field will be populated automatically.
- In case you enable Use Security, select FTP connection type from the Connection Type drop-down list. FTP can run in either passive or active mode. The information about the connection type should be provided by the FTP host. If you wish to use FTP over SSL, enable the Use Security checkbox and choose the connection method Implicit SSL,Explicit SSL or SSH.
- Enter the Username and Password fields provided by the source.
- Click Test Connection. If the connection is successful, a green check sign is displayed.
- To enable anonymous FTP connections, enable the Anonymous Access checkbox which is the default settings.
